COVID-19 in Quebec: What you need to know Thursday – CBC.ca
Quebec has been reserving half its vaccine doses in order to ensure people receive their second doses, which provide much stronger protection against COVID-19.

- Quebec reported 2,819 new cases on Thursday and 62 more deaths, 22 of which occurred in the last 24 hours.
- Since the start of the pandemic, there have been 202,641 confirmed cases and 8,226 people have died. One death was withdrawn from the count after an investigation showed it wasn’t related to COVID-19. Here’s a guide to the numbers.
- There are 1,175 people in hospital (a decrease of 36), including 165 intensive care (an increase of 13).
